The Portland Town Meeting on the Future of Media

Thursday June 24th
Time: 5:30 pm - 9:30 pm
Title: FCC town hall meeting
Portland, OR
Location: Oregon Convention Center, 777 NE MLK Blvd.
Speaker: FCC & You
Topic/Issue: Media

Oregon Convention Center
Oregon Ballroom #204
777 NE Martin Luther King, Jr. Blvd

Featuring special guests Federal Communications Commissioners Michael Copps and Jonathan Adelstein.

Confirmed panelists include:

* Michael Powell, Owner of Powell's City of Books (not the spoiled child of a war criminal)
* David Leiken, Owner of Double Tee Productions
* Madylyn Elder, President of Communications Workers of America Local 7901
* Michael Brown, President of Brown Broadcast Services
* David Olsen, Executive Director of Mt. Hood Cable Regulatory Commission
* Nigel Ballard, Wireless Director for Matrix Networks, Member of the Portland Telecommunications Steering Committee
* L.C. Hansen, KBOO Board Member

This event is free and open to the public, and is presented in partnership with City Club of Portland, MIPRAP, Jobs With Justice, Communications Workers of America Local 7901, American Federation of Musicians Local 99, and the Mt. Hood Cable Regulatory Commission.
